Get started3 Foss Court is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Bristol (BS5 8HF). It has a recorded floor area of 68 m² (around 732 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band B. At 68 m² this is the smallest unit on EPC record across the building (68–70 m²). The building's EPC ratings span D to C, with this unit at the top. On EPC score it ranks first in the building (76 versus a worst of 65). The latest certificate (September 2015) shows a C (score 76), near the top of the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 81). The latest certificate is from September 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 2.8%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£231,000 is 19.1%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£265/sq ft) was about 50.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: September 2021 at £194,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
